pukka
adjective: If you describe something or someone as pukka, you mean that they are real or genuine, and of good quality.

pukka in American English
good or first-rate of its kind
adjective: genuine, reliable, or good; proper

pukka in British English
adjective: properly or perfectly done, constructed, etc
